Welcome to the Wild World of Mushroom Foraging

After twenty years of wandering through forests with my basket and field guide, I've learned that mushroom foraging is much more than hunting for dinnerโ€”it's about connecting with nature, understanding ecosystems, and developing a deep respect for the fungal kingdom that quietly sustains our world.

Whether you're a complete beginner wondering where to start or an experienced forager looking to expand your knowledge, this journal chronicles my adventures, discoveries, and hard-learned lessons from the forest floor.
